"BELGRADE, Serbia-Montenegro (AP) -- The arrest in Serbia of a top terrorist fugitive has raised fresh concerns of an al-Qaida presence in the volatile Balkans, where thousands of U.S. and other international troops are stationed as peacekeepers.

Abdelmajid Bouchar, a 22-year-old Moroccan, sought for involvement in last year's train bombings in the Spanish capital Madrid, that killed nearly 200 people, was caught at the Belgrade railway station in June.

The arrest, revealed earlier this month, revived concerns that the Balkans - with its porous borders, unsophisticated security systems, rampant corruption and organized crime - could serve as a haven for al-Qaida-linked terrorist groups.

Local officials and experts have long warned that the Balkans at least is a major transit route for the terrorists, as well as for organized crime, including human and drug trafficking. They said the two often go hand in hand..."

What's more, Kathryn Bolkovac, a U.N. International Police Force monitor filed a lawsuit in Britain in 2001 against DynCorp for firing her after she reported that Dyncorp police trainers in Bosnia were paying for prostitutes and participating in sex trafficking. Many of the Dyncorp employees were forced to resign under suspicion of illegal activity. But none were prosecuted, since they enjoy immunity from prosecution in Bosnia.

Earlier that year Ben Johnston, a DynCorp aircraft mechanic for Apache and Blackhawk helicopters in Kosovo, filed a lawsuit against his employer. The suit alleged that that in the latter part of 1999 Johnson "learned that employees and supervisors from DynCorp were engaging in perverse, illegal and inhumane behavior [and] were purchasing illegal weapons, women, forged passports and [participating in] other immoral acts."

The suit charges that "Johnston witnessed coworkers and supervisors literally buying and selling women for their own personal enjoyment, and employees would brag about the various ages and talents of the individual slaves they had purchased." "DynCorp is just as immoral and elite as possible, and any rule they can break they do," Johnston told Insight magazine. He charged that the company also billed the Army for unnecessary repairs and padded the payroll. "What they say in Bosnia is that DynCorp just needs a warm body -- that's the DynCorp slogan. Even if you don't do an eight-hour day, they'll sign you in for it because that's how they bill the government. It's a total fraud."

The balkans are apparently used as more of a staging area rather than a place where outright jihadist terrorism occurs. They'll move members who've been injured in iraq into the balkans, while recruiting amoung the albanians and others to send more fighters to iraq. This network apparently also is invovled in european terrorism, but not strictly speaking, in the balkans itself. Apparently they're helping to get german military grade explosives and weapons to 'homegrown' terrorists in the other european countries.
